Forest 1Definition: An extensive wood; a large tract of land covered with trees; in the United States, a wood of native growth, or a tract of woodland which has never been cultivated.
Forest 2Definition: A large extent or precinct of country, generally waste and woody, belonging to the sovereign, set apart for the keeping of game for his use, not inclosed, but distinguished by certain limits, and protected by certain laws, courts, and officers of its own. Forest 3Definition: Of or pertaining to a forest; sylvan. Forest 4Definition: To cover with trees or wood. forest 5Definition: the trees and other plants in a large densely wooded area forest 6Definition: land that is covered with trees and shrubs forest 7Definition: establish a forest on previously unforested land; "afforest the mountains"
